
Soha Ali Khan, the Bollywood star and author, has taken a fun new turn as a podcaster. She launched her own podcast series on YouTube back on August 22, chatting with inspiring women from all walks of life about their journeys and life lessons. Fans love her warm, witty style and honest talks that feel like a cozy conversation.
In the latest episode, Soha welcomes Union Minister Smriti Irani for a heartfelt discussion on her political career. Smriti opens up about overcoming stereotypes as a former actor and how she built her path through real grassroots work.
Soha asked if being a famous face helped or hurt her in politics. Smriti didn’t hold back: “It’s a disadvantage. People assume actors jump into politics just to wind down their careers, not to get serious from the ground up. Most get parachuted in because of their popularity and end up as Rajya Sabha members.”
She shared how she proved everyone wrong. “I joined active politics in 2003 as a youth wing member of the BJP in Maharashtra. My batchmate is now the Chief Minister there, and another colleague, Dharmendra Pradhan, is the Education Minister. But I wanted to earn respect by working in the trenches with my team—I knew I was in it for the long run.”
Smriti climbed the ranks, becoming State Secretary in Maharashtra under Nitin Gadkari’s presidency. She’s worked with five BJP presidents: Rajnath Singh, Nitin Gadkari, Amit Shah, J.P. Nadda, and Venkaiah Naidu. At just 27, she fought her first election in 2004. “So, I can say, ‘Been there, done that,'” she added with a laugh.
